Are there OHC conversion kit for Windor blocks?
I was just wondering if anybody made SOHC or DOHC heads that bolts to a Windsor. If they had, what all is involved in getting that working. Does it do VVT/VCT? What intake and exhaust headers would it work with (4.6L, std 5.0, or custom)? And more importantly, what are the gains?

Re: Are there OHC conversion kit for Windor blocks?
Chris,
Do a Google on Gurney-Westlake heads, that's the only one I have ever heard of. Used to run them with the indy cars on the SBF's. Ran good but better have some really deep pockets for them. Last I saw, they run about 20-25K. Haven't seen anything done in the later years. Way too many improvements made over the years. The latest 5.0 is partly based on that Indy car, that's where the Coyote name came from. Both Malcolm and I can get close to 500 rwhp and around 20 mpg and still be a mild a very streetable car. See Ford now has a stand alone wiring harness and computer for the 4.6 3V motor. What are you looking for?

Re: Are there OHC conversion kit for Windor blocks?
Actually back in the mid to late sixties someone developed a sohc kit for the 289 and had one in a Mustang.
I remember seeing the kits for about 2 months in car magazine articles and then they just went away. Rumor was that Ford bought them out. I never really saw one myself. It was about the same time Pontiac was using the OHC sixs in Firebirds.
